Output af8058d3e0d4fbd9a70e839c1687d88c1c883b2ef12c90c7cb4156bcc3f57f6d:1

value
137984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 283926e09265ae74aa08474d59ddb4211f78416b OP_EQUAL
address
35MhRCShTNx5z67zrTRNhkg4Qasarw3ZSz
transaction
af8058d3e0d4fbd9a70e839c1687d88c1c883b2ef12c90c7cb4156bcc3f57f6d
confirmations
95383
spent
true